Denise Dunford, DNS, FNP-BC, APRN, has been named director of the advanced practice environment for Kaleida Health.
Among other responsibilities, Dr. Dunford will work with advanced practice providers (APP) across Kaleida Health to organize an APP Council that would engage APPs in making decisions about their work and develop ongoing professional opportunities, including a clinical ladder.
Dr. Dunford is a recognized leader on issues affecting advanced practice, such as educational preparation, state licensure, professional certification, contracts, onboarding, interprofessional practice, collaborative agreements, accreditation, and workplace requirements. She will report directly to Cheryl Klass, chief nurse executive and chief operating officer for Kaleida Health.
While this is a new role, Dr. Dunford has worked at Buffalo General Medical Center for 43 years beginning as a med-surg nurse from 1980-1995 and as a nurse practitioner for the last 28 years in the Emergency Department (ED). From 1998 to spring 2022, Dr. Dunford balanced clinical work in the ED with teaching at D’Youville University. Dr. Dunford’s academic position expanded from direct classroom instruction to becoming the Family Nurse Practitioner (FNP) program director, graduate chair, doctoral program director and assistant dean.
Dr. Dunford earned her bachelor’s degree from D’Youville University and her master’s and doctoral degrees from the State University of New York at Buffalo. She is double board certified as a Family Nurse Practitioner and an Emergency Nurse Practitioner. In addition, she serves as a trustee on the Board of Directors for the Health Foundation of Western and Central New York (HFWCNY).
After a short transition period, Dr. Dunford plans to hold in-person and virtual town hall meetings with APPs to gather their perspectives on the practice environment.
